About PE Ratio (TTM)
CrossAmerica Partners LP has a trailing-twelve-months P/E of 37.63X compared to the Oil and Gas - Refining and Marketing - Master Limited Partnerships industry's P/E of 21.77X.
Price to Earnings Ratio or P/E is price / earnings. It is the most commonly used metric for determining a company's value relative to its earnings. In this example, we are using the actual earnings (EPS) for the trailing twelve months (or TTM). A stock with a P/E ratio of 20, for example, is said to be trading at 20 times its trailing twelve months earnings. In general, a lower number or multiple is usually considered better than a higher one.
